Product Description

Product Description

Tom Clancy’s The Division is a ground-breaking RPG experience that brings the genre into a modern military setting for the first time. In the wake of a devastating pandemic that sweeps through New York City, basic services fail one by one, and without access to food or water, the city quickly descends into chaos. As an agent of The Division, you’ll specialize, modify, and level up your gear, weapons, and skills to take back New York on your own terms.

From the Manufacturer


Minimum Configuration
Supported OS: Windows 7, Windows 8.1, Windows 10 (64-bit versions only).
Processor: Intel Core i5-2400 | AMD FX-6100, or better.
RAM: 6GB
Video Card: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 560 with 2 GB VRAM (current equivalent NVIDIA GeForce GTX 760) | AMD Radeon HD 7770 with 2 GB VRAM, or better
Notebook support: Laptop models of these desktop cards may work as long as they are on-par in terms of performance with at least the minimum configuration. For an up-to-date list of supported hardware, please visit the FAQ for this game on Ubisoft’s website
DirectX: Version 11
Hard Drive Space: 40 GB available space.
Optical Drive: DVD-ROM Dual Layer.
Peripherals Supported: Windows-compatible keyboard, mouse, headset, optional controller.
Multiplayer: Broadband connection with 256 kbps upstream, or faster.

Recommended Configuration
Supported OS: Windows 7, Windows 8.1, Windows 10 (64-bit versions only)
Processor: Intel Core i7-3770 | AMD FX-8350, or better.
RAM: 8GB
Video Card: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 970 | AMD Radeon R9 290, or better
Notebook support: Laptop models of these desktop cards may work as long as they are on-par in terms of performance with at least the minimum configuration. For an up-to-date list of supported hardware, please visit the FAQ for this game on Ubisoft’s website
DirectX: Version 11
Hard Drive Space: 40 GB available space.
Optical Drive: DVD-ROM Dual Layer.
Peripherals Supported: Windows-compatible keyboard, mouse, headset, optional controller.
Multiplayer: Broadband connection with 512 kbps upstream, or faster.

Take Back New York

Welcome to a next-gen experience in a persistent and dynamic open world environment that is built from the ground up for co-op and where exploration and player progression are essential. Teaming up with other Division agents, your mission is to restore order, investigate the source of the virus, and take back New York.

Seamless Multiplayer: The Dark Zone

Enter the Dark Zone, a walled-off quarantine zone in the middle of Manhattan where the most valuable loot was left behind when the military evacuated. It’s also the most dangerous area in the game, where fear, betrayal, and tension are high. Team up with other players to take down your enemies and extract legendary loot via helicopter. It’s your choice to collaborate with other agents, or attack them and steal their loot.

Urban Jungle

New York City is being overrun by hostile groups trying to take advantage of the crisis. Beware of the thugs who roam in packs through the city, preying on the weak. Fight against the Cleaners, who wear hazmat suits and wield flamethrowers, set on cleaning New York from the virus by burning everything and everyone. Engage with the Rikers, a gang of convicts that escaped Rikers Island when the chaos hit, and who are ravaging the city and vying for its control.

Gear Up and Customize your Agent

Harness state-of-the-art technology, both networked and prototype, as a member of The Division. Customize your character and your backpack, your lifeline in mid-crisis New York. Communicate with other agents at all times with your smartwatch. Loot fallen enemies and customize and level up your weapons, gear, and skills.

Great game even with hackers
5 Stars
Great game even with hackers
I have put about 150 hours into this game and let me tell you it is worth every penny.Pros:Superb GraphicsExcellent 3rd person controlsCustomized weapon mods and gearMany aspects of the game to play (single & multiplayer)Player vs Player is very excitingHours really fly by when playingMeet many fun people/friendsCons:Hackers galoreRepetitive game playAs you can see I enjoy the game a lot. Lots of diverse things to do: missions, side missions, pickup gear/weapons, dark zone exploring, co-op action, and I meet a lot of good people. There is one draw back though if you're considering buying the PC version. Unfortunately there are many players that are using cheats in this version of the game. For example, there are cheats to shoot all the ammo out of your magazine with one shot. There are cheats that people use to see through walls. And just another cheat I've seen is they can teleport to anywhere in the Dark Zone. Now I know it sounds bad but honestly the pros outweigh the cons. When I get killed by a cheater I just switch servers or go back to single player action or I keep going back to the cheater and let them kill me while I record it over and over and over. If that's not fun anymore I hook up with 3 other players and do missions. Like I said before I've met a lot of good people on this game and roaming with them in the Dark Zone is fun. Oh and before I forget, there are some graphic glitches (see photo) but nobody's perfect :)
